Perth Airport calling on EOIs for new retail opportunities within Terminals 3 and 4

30 April, 2025

Perth Airport is calling for retailers across food & beverage, news and books, and specialty categories to bid on up to 13 sites across Terminal 3 and Terminal 4.

Perth Airport Chief Commercial & Aviation Officer, Kate Holsgrove said as part of our ongoing commitment to optimise the customer experience at Perth Airport we are embarking on a refurbishment and refresh of the retail offering within our T3/T4 infrastructure.

“Even though we are designing and building new terminal facilities within the Airport Central precinct for Qantas Group to relocate in 2031, we are committed to upgrade the current T3/T4 terminals to ensure we are catering for passengers in the interim.

“Retailers are invited to explore the opportunities available at Perth Airport by connecting to the millions of passengers that travel through our terminals each year.

“These terminals offer strong potential for retailers specialising in food and beverage, travel essentials, books and magazines, and a broad range of speciality stores including gifts, fashion, beauty, apparel, kids, athleisure, and accessories.

“Our Commercial team is looking to engage with potential partners via a Request for Proposals program for up to 13 sites across T3 and T4.”
